summ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orRich Ercolani <rincebrain@gmail.com>2022-03-01 08:34:29 -0500
committerBrian Behlendorf <behlendorf1@llnl.gov>2022-03-01 13:55:51 -0800
commite2206359955de08a43373eff761af278bfd96d3f (patch)
treec69b1f372d11039c4b371b69b8fe70936515c562
parent234e9605c1f2cdf64f13df0697aa5017f416656a (diff)
Re-apply a78f19d3
Reviewed-by: Brian Behlendorf <behlendorf1@llnl.gov> Signed-off-by: Rich Ercolani <rincebrain@gmail.com> Closes #12978
-rw-r--r--module/zstd/include/zstd_compat_wrapper.h1
-rw-r--r--module/zstd/lib/common/zstd_common.c2
-rw-r--r--module/zstd/lib/common/zstd_internal.h1
3 files changed, 2 insertions, 2 deletions
diff --git a/module/zstd/include/zstd_compat_wrapper.h b/module/zstd/include/zstd_compat_wrapper.h
index ad8879ed8..c39dfa2db 100644
--- a/module/zstd/include/zstd_compat_wrapper.h
+++ b/module/zstd/include/zstd_compat_wrapper.h
@@ -420,6 +420,7 @@
zfs_ZSTD_insertAndFindFirstIndex_internal
#define ZSTD_insertBlock zfs_ZSTD_insertBlock
#define ZSTD_invalidateRepCodes zfs_ZSTD_invalidateRepCodes
+#define ZSTD_isError zfs_ZSTD_isError
#define ZSTD_isFrame zfs_ZSTD_isFrame
#define ZSTD_ldm_adjustParameters zfs_ZSTD_ldm_adjustParameters
#define ZSTD_ldm_blockCompress zfs_ZSTD_ldm_blockCompress
diff --git a/module/zstd/lib/common/zstd_common.c b/module/zstd/lib/common/zstd_common.c
index 91fe3323a..935670b1d 100644
--- a/module/zstd/lib/common/zstd_common.c
+++ b/module/zstd/lib/common/zstd_common.c
@@ -30,7 +30,7 @@ const char* ZSTD_versionString(void) { return ZSTD_VERSION_STRING; }
/*-****************************************
* ZSTD Error Management
******************************************/
-#undef ZSTD_isError /* defined within zstd_internal.h */
+
/*! ZSTD_isError() :
* tells if a return value is an error code
* symbol is required for external callers */
diff --git a/module/zstd/lib/common/zstd_internal.h b/module/zstd/lib/common/zstd_internal.h
index 3bc7e55a0..20899575b 100644
--- a/module/zstd/lib/common/zstd_internal.h
+++ b/module/zstd/lib/common/zstd_internal.h
@@ -43,7 +43,6 @@ extern "C" {
/* ---- static assert (debug) --- */
#define ZSTD_STATIC_ASSERT(c) DEBUG_STATIC_ASSERT(c)
-#define ZSTD_isError ERR_isError /* for inlining */
#define FSE_isError ERR_isError
#define HUF_isError ERR_isError